Claims (1)
- 【特許請求の範囲】 1. コードラインと、ピッチ軸と、前縁端部分と、後縁端部分と、を有する翼 に外側スキン層を取り付けるための方法であって、該方法は、 a) 前記翼の前記前縁端領域内において前記スキン層に均一な実質的に高 い圧力を加えて、厳密に制御された曲率を有し、かつ、前記翼の前記前縁端領域 を被覆する前記スキン層を与えるステップと、 b) 前記翼の前記後縁端領域内において、前記スキン層に均一な変形圧力 を加え、かつ、前記翼の前記後縁端領域にわたって前記スキンに均一な圧力を加 えて、内側翼部品の寸法変動によらずに前記後縁端領域に前記スキン層を滑らか に結合させるステップと、を有することを特徴とする翼に外側スキン層を取り付 けるための方法。 2. 前記ピッチ軸を通り、かつ、前記コードラインに垂直なラインの前記前縁 端領域側上の前記翼領域内において、前記高圧を前記スキン層へと加えることを 特徴とする請求項1に記載の方法。 3. コードラインと、ピッチ軸と、前縁端領域と、後縁端領域とを有する翼に 外側スキン層を取り付けるための成形アッセンブリであって、該成形アッセンブ リは、 a) 前記翼の一つの面形状を画成するキャビティを有する金型 ボディと、 b) 前記金型ボディと協働し、前記スキン層が前記翼に取り付けられると、 前記翼の形状へと成形するカウルプレートを有し、このカウルプレートは、前記 翼における対向する側の面形状を画成し、かつ、前記翼の前記前縁端領域の一方 の側を形成する剛性のある前端領域と、前記スキン層が前記翼に取り付けられる と、前記翼の前記後縁端領域の一方の側を形成する変形自在後方領域と、を有し ていることを特徴とする成形アッセンブリ。 4. 前記カウルプレートの前記剛性前端部領域の壁は厚くされており、かつ、 前記カウルプレートの前記変形自在後方端領域は、壁が薄くされていることを特 徴とする請求項3に記載の成形アッセンブリ。 5. 前記カウルプレートには、前記剛性前端領域と前記変形自在後方端領域の 間に中間領域が備えられており、前記中間領域は、前記剛性前端領域から前記変 形自在後方領域まで壁厚が漸減して行くようにされていることを特徴とする請求 項4に記載の成形アッセンブリ。 6. 前記カウルプレートの前記剛性前端領域は、本質的にスパー上の前記前縁 端領域上まで配置されていることを特徴とする請求項5に記載の成形アッセンブ リ。 7. 前記翼は、内側スパーを備えており、前記カウルプレートの前記変形自在 領域は、本質的にハニカムコア上の前記翼後縁端領域にまで配置されていること を特徴とする請求項6に記載の成形アッセンブリ。 8. 前記カウルプレートは、予め含浸された複合材の重ね合わされた複数のプ ライから形成され、前記剛性前端領域の重ね合わされた複合材プライの数は、前 記変形自在後方端領域における重ね合わされたシートの数よりも多くされている ことを特徴とする請求項3に記載の成形アッセンブリ。 9. 前記カウルプレートの前記剛性前端領域は、前記カウルプレートの前記変 形自在後方端部の剛性の少なくとも2倍であることを特徴とする請求項3に記載 の成形アッセンブリ。 10. 前記カウルプレートの前記変形自在端部領域は、前記翼に取り付けられ る前記外側スキン層の剛性の6倍の剛性を有していることを特徴とする請求項9 に記載の成形アッセンブリ。 11. コードラインと、ピッチ軸と、前縁端領域と、後縁端領域と、を有する 翼に外側スキン層を取り付けるための成形アッセンブリに用いるカウルプレート であって、前記カウルプレートは、前記スキン層が前記翼に取り付けられた場合 に、前記翼前縁端領域である一方の側を画成する剛性の前端領域と、前記スキン 層が前記翼に 取り付けられた場合に、前記翼後縁端領域である一方の側を画成する変形自在後 方端領域とを有していることを特徴とするカウルプレート。 12. 前記剛性前部端領域は、壁が厚くされており、前記変形自在後方端領域 は、壁が薄くされていることを特徴とする請求項11に記載のカウルプレート。 13. 前記剛性前部端領域と、前記変形自在後方端領域と、を連結する中間領 域をさらに有し、前記中間領域は、前記剛性前部端領域から前記変形自在後方端 領域まで壁厚が漸減していることを特徴とする請求項12に記載のカウルプレー ト。 14. 前記カウルプレートは、あらかじめ含浸された複合材の重ね合わされた 複数のシートから形成され、前記剛性前端領域の重ね合わされた複合材シートの 数は、前記変形自在後方端領域内の重なり合わされた複合材シートの数よりも多 くされていることを特徴とする請求項12に記載のカウルプレート。 15. 前記カウルプレートの前記剛性前端領域は、前記カウルプレートの変形 自在後方端部の剛性の少なくとも2倍であることを特徴とする請求項11に記載 のカウルプレート。 16. 前記カウルプレートの前記変形自在端部領域は、前記翼に 取り付けられる前記外側スキン層の剛性の6倍の剛性を有していることを特徴と する請求項15に記載のカウルプレート。
